View Of Toledo by El Greco

The storm erupted from a charcoal-bruised sky lashing spindles of platinum rain upon an emerald heath tossed in trenchant wind. Among the hedgerows and linden the first spires emerged like shoots from turned loam followed by the pitch of tiled-stone roofs and pewter walls of lambent unblemished granite. The damp auburn clay, etched by a teal river, birthed a soaring imperial city, its cerulean patina to ever scintillate in sun's timeless effulgence.
